Fully Homomorphic Encryption

Fully Homomorphic Encryption is the most advanced form of homomorphic encryption, allowing for an arbitrary number of computations on encrypted data. It enables complex financial models to be executed on encrypted datasets without ever decrypting them.

This allows for the development of highly secure, privacy-first financial platforms where all data is protected at rest, in transit, and during computation. It is the holy grail of data privacy in finance, as it enables deep analysis of sensitive information without any risk of data exposure.

While computationally intensive, recent advancements are making it increasingly practical for real-world applications. It is a transformative technology that will redefine the standards of privacy in the digital asset industry.
